#01e397 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#01e397 is composed of 0.4% red, 89% green and 59.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 99.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 33.5%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 159.8 degrees, a saturation of 99.1% and a lightness of 44.7%. #01e397 color hex could be obtained by blending #02ffff with #00c72f. Closest websafe color is: #00cc99.

#01e397 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#01e397 has RGB values of R:1, G:227, B:151 and CMYK values of C:1, M:0, Y:0.33,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 123799.
